Toshiba Buying Out Panasonic LCD Stake

March 30, 2009
Get the Flash Player to see this rotator.
 
Toshiba is planning to take full possession of its LCD production joint venture with Panasonic, sources told Reuters.

According to the report, Toshiba, which currently owns Toshiba Matsushita Display Technology on a 60/40 basis, will purchase the rest from Panasonic, for "several billion yen." The venture is the world's second-largest producer of small-to-medium LCD panels, such as those used in cell phones.

Panasonic will still own a small stake in a small-LCD joint venture with Hitachi.
